Greg T. for Model Number GE Washing Machine WJSR2080T8WW I need to replace the Agitator Coupler. I just want to make sure this new version will fit my 18-year-old model. Also, the grooves on the drive shaft seem about 15-20% worn down, will this affect the longevity of the new coupler?
Answer Hello Greg, The coupler splines are plastic and the splines on the shaft are steel. The shaft splines will not wear against the plastic. The plastic splines are the ones that wear out and when looking inside it, they normally look good until touching them with a small screwdriver or something when it becomes apparent that the splines are actually the grease to prevent the shaft from rusting has taken the shape of the splines. Replacing the coupler WH49X10042 will correct your issue and the shaft should not be a concern. Read More... Answered by AppliancePartsPros.com | Saturday, May 26, 2018
